Join Housatonic Habitat for Humanity for a free workshop designed to help prepare for the future with confidence.
This educational session will focus on practical ways to remain safe, independent, and organized while aging at home. Attendees will learn about Housatonic Habitat for Humanity’s Aging in Place Program, which provides free safety home repairs for qualifying low-income seniors, veterans, and individuals with disabilities.
We will also introduce our Records & Wishes guide, a helpful resource that assists individuals and families with organizing important personal, medical, and household information in case of an emergency or unexpected life event.
Whether you are planning for yourself or helping a loved one prepare for the future, this workshop will provide valuable information, resources, and peace of mind.
